Who was Raja Sen? Three-time National Award winner dies at 71 · livemint.com

Raja Sen was a famous filmmaker from Bengal who made movies and TV shows.

He died at a hospital in Kolkata on August 16 after being sick for a long time.

He was 71 years old.

Raja Sen made many TV shows, like Subarnalata, which many people loved.

He also made documentaries about famous artists and cultural traditions.

He won three big awards called National Film Awards for his work.

One of his movies was about a boy and an elephant, called Damu.

He also made movies with famous actors like Jaya Bachchan and Abhishek Bachchan.

Raja Sen had health problems for many years, starting after an injury on a movie set.

He will be remembered for his great films and TV shows.

Key facts

Age at death
71
Date of death
16 August
Place of death
SSKM Hospital, Kolkata
National Film Awards
Three (Suchitra Mitra, Damu, Atmiyo Swajan)
Breakthrough TV serial
Subarnalata
Feature film debut
Damu
Indira Gandhi Lifetime Achievement Award
2015
Dada Saheb Phalke Film Festival Best Director
2016 for Maya Mridanga
